Commercial Slab Construction in Marietta, GA
Commercial slab construction services involve the design and installation of concrete foundations for a variety of commercial properties, including warehouses, retail stores, office buildings, and industrial facilities. These projects typically require a durable, level concrete slab that can support heavy equipment, foot traffic, or storage needs. Property owners often seek information about the scope of the work, including site preparation, concrete thickness, reinforcement options, and finishing details, to ensure the foundation will meet the specific demands of their project.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the planning considerations, such as soil conditions, load requirements, and local building codes. Clarifying these factors helps determine the appropriate type of slab and any additional features like insulation or joint placement. Proper planning and understanding of the process can contribute to a stable, long-lasting foundation that supports the intended use of the property.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ial parking lots - durable concrete slabs designed to support heavy vehicle traffic.
Warehouse floors - flat, strong slabs that provide a stable foundation for storage and equipment.
Retail store foundations - reinforced slabs that create a level base for building construction.
Loading docks - heavy-duty concrete surfaces built to withstand frequent vehicle loading and unloading.
Industrial facilities - large-scale slab construction to accommodate manufacturing and operational needs.
Outdoor service areas - concrete slabs that offer long-lasting surfaces for various commercial activities.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a concrete slab? Commercial slabs are used for parking lots, loading docks, warehouse floors, and retail spaces to provide a durable foundation.
How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? The thickness varies based on usage but generally ranges from 4 to 6 inches for standard commercial applications.
What factors influence the durability of a concrete slab? Proper subgrade preparation, quality materials, and appropriate reinforcement contribute to the longevity of the slab.
Is a permit needed for commercial slab construction? Local building codes typically require permits for commercial concrete slab projects to ensure compliance with safety standards.
